What's with the sharp-edged T500 palmrest?
I've had my T500 for a week, and really like it. The LED backlit screen is so much brighter and easier to work with (than the T60 screen). I'm running with 6 GB of RAM, a 500 GB Momentus 7200.4 HDD, and 64 bit Vista Ultimate. This laptop really moves.
I have also been pleasantly surprised with program compatibility. Just about every program that I own runs fine on the 64 bit Vista system. I was expecting more difficulties along those lines.
My only complaint is the palmrest. Unlike the T60 palmrest, the one on the T500 has a sharply defined front and right side edge. I find this to be very annoying. I am continually scraping my palm against those sharp edges. I think that it also gives the palmrest (and the whole laptop) a cheaper feel.
Perhaps I just have a "Monday-morning" palm rest. I'd be interested in hearing whether others have noticed a similar problem on their T500s.
I finally took off the plamrest to see if I could repair the situation. My "tools" were a piece of fine grade sand paper and a bit of fine steel wool. I stroked the edge of the palmrest at a 45 degree angle lightly with the sand paper. The emphasis here is LIGHTLY. It does not take much pressure at all to sand off that sharp edge. I couple of light strokes is all that you need.
I then buffed it lightly with steel wool. The result was very satisfying. The palmrest now feels like the palmrest from my T60.
If you plan to "try this at home" be be sure to remove the palmrest before doing this. Otherwise you may get plastic "dust" under your keyboard.

First, my mistake. My ultrabay HDD is 250GB rather than 320GB. I forgot which one came with the laptop.basketb wrote:Would you mind posting HDtach/HDtune benchmarks for your 500gb drive (and as a comparison for your 320gb ultrabay drive? thx.
Second, I can't get HDtach to work on my 64-bit system. In compatability mode it says I'm not logged in as administrator (but I am).
Third, here are the results for HDtune.
HD Tune: ST9500420AS Benchmark (500 GB drive, 7600rpm, primary drive)
Transfer Rate Minimum : 36.0 MB/sec
Transfer Rate Maximum : 99.0 MB/sec
Transfer Rate Average : 73.0 MB/sec
Access Time : 17.9 ms
Burst Rate : 48.5 MB/sec
CPU Usage : 13.1%
HD Tune: ST9500420AS Information
http://baertracks.com/thinkpads/HDTune_ ... 0420AS.png
HD Tune: HITACHI HTS543225L9S Benchmark (250GB, 5400rpm, ultrabay drive)
Transfer Rate Minimum : 5.2 MB/sec
Transfer Rate Maximum : 66.9 MB/sec
Transfer Rate Average : 50.5 MB/sec
Access Time : 17.8 ms
Burst Rate : 76.5 MB/sec
CPU Usage : 13.5%

Hm, while the 7200.4 definitely has impressive throughputs, its access times are even worse than the ones of its precedessor. For comparison the access times of my 7K200 are about 14.7ms. I remember reading somewhere Seagate claiming about 12ms for the 7200.4, that´s not even close...
